Subtract 63/30 from 50/12
1st number: 4 2/12, 2nd number: 2 3/30
50/12 - 63/30 is 31/15.
Steps for subtracting f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 12 and 30 is 60
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 60 - For the 1st fraction, since 12 × 5 = 60,
50/12 = 50 × 5/12 × 5 = 250/60 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 30 × 2 = 60,
63/30 = 63 × 2/30 × 2 = 126/60 - Subtract the two like fractions:
250/60 - 126/60 = 250 - 126/60 = 124/60 - After reducing the fraction, the answer is 31/15
- In mixed form: 21/15
